Product

Icon

PRP lead candidate

PRP is Propanc Biopharma, Inc.’s lead therapeutic candidate and remains in preclinical development, so it has no approved sales yet. The product line has 0 commercial cancer launches, which keeps current revenue tied to R&D spending, not product demand. That makes PRP a pipeline story first, with value still dependent on preclinical data and regulatory progress.

Icon

Pancreatic, ovarian, colorectal focus

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. keeps its pipeline tightly focused on pancreatic, ovarian, and colorectal cancers, three of the hardest oncology markets. Pancreatic cancer still has a roughly 13% 5-year relative survival rate, so the need is acute. That narrow scope targets high-unmet-need tumors, where even small gains can matter.

Enzyme-based formulation

Propanc Biopharma, Inc.'s enzyme-based formulation, PRP, is positioned as a unique mix that is designed to boost the activity of multiple enzymes. Its goal is to support anti-cancer effects by helping target the biochemical pathways tied to tumor growth. The product sits in a pre-commercial stage, so its value is tied more to clinical progress than current sales.

POP1 joint program

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. is working with the University of Jaén on POP1, a joint drug discovery program that widens the research pipeline beyond PRP. The tie-up is still early-stage, so its value in the 4P mix sits in Product development and pipeline depth, not sales today. Propanc had no reported product revenue in its latest public filings.

  • Joint discovery work with University of Jaén
  • Expands pipeline beyond PRP
  • Early-stage, no current sales impact

No approved therapy

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. has no FDA-approved or marketed product, so this "product" slot in the 4P mix is still empty. The business remains development-stage, and revenue is not driven by product sales; in fiscal 2025, product revenue was $0.

That means the company’s value depends on clinical progress, financing, and future approvals, not on current commercial demand. One line: there is no approved therapy to sell yet.

  • No FDA-approved therapy
  • No marketed product
  • Development-stage company
  • Fiscal 2025 product revenue: $0

Place

Icon

Camberwell, Australia HQ

Propanc Biopharma is headquartered in Camberwell, Victoria, Australia, while its securities trade in the U.S. market. That split shows an Australia-based operating core with a public investor base in the U.S. The Camberwell site is corporate and research oriented, so place supports oversight, drug development, and scientific work rather than heavy manufacturing.

Icon

Australian biotech base

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. is an Australian biopharmaceutical company with a small U.S. listing and no retail distribution model. Its work centers on oncology R&D, especially cancer treatment candidates, not consumer sales. As a development-stage biotech, its value comes from pipeline progress and clinical data, not store reach or channel scale.

University of Jaén, Spain

Propanc Biopharma’s work with the University of Jaén in Spain places part of the POP1 discovery program inside a European academic setting, which broadens access to specialist research talent and lab infrastructure. This cross-border setup can speed early-stage validation and lower dependence on one site. The collaboration also fits a lean R&D model, where external academic partners help extend capability without heavy fixed costs.

Preclinical research setting

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. is still in the preclinical stage, so product access is limited to laboratory and research channels only. There is no commercial hospital or pharmacy distribution yet, and latest filings show zero commercial product revenue. That makes the place strategy tightly focused on R&D sites, not patients.

  • Preclinical only
  • Lab and research access
  • No hospital or pharmacy sales
  • Zero commercial product revenue

No sales channels

Propanc Biopharma has no commercial product network, so there are no direct-to-consumer or retail sales channels to manage. In its most recent fiscal 2025 reporting, the Company still showed $0 product revenue, which fits a pre-commercial stage. For now, distribution is not a marketing priority because the Company has no launched product to place.

  • No retail channels
  • No direct-to-consumer sales
  • Fiscal 2025 product revenue: $0
  • Distribution remains non-core

Promotion

Icon

Press releases

Propanc Biopharma uses corporate press releases to promote pipeline and collaboration updates, giving investors a direct read on progress. For a pre-revenue biotech, this low-cost channel matters because every milestone can move sentiment and trading interest. In 2025, it remained a key way to keep the market informed.

Icon

Investor relations updates

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. uses investor relations updates to keep shareholders informed on pipeline progress, a key task for a small public biotech with 0 commercial products. The message is milestone-led, centered on preclinical and regulatory steps that can move valuation. For a company with no product sales, each update can matter more than revenue: it is the main proof of progress.

Explore a Preview
Icon

Public filings

Propanc Biopharma uses SEC filings like Forms 10-K and 10-Q to share financial and operating updates, giving investors a clear view of cash use, going-concern risk, and development progress. In its latest public reports, the company disclosed continued losses and very limited revenue, so these filings are the main channel for timely market transparency and compliance.

PPCB ticker visibility

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. trades under PPCB, so its ticker works as indirect promotion every time investors, screens, and news feeds display the name. Public trading status also gives the company market visibility and makes it easier to track through SEC filings and quote pages. In 2025/2026, that visibility matters most for a microcap name, where attention can be as important as ad spend.

  • PPCB is a public ticker, not a private brand.
  • Market listings boost name recognition.
  • Trading data creates daily exposure.

Research collaboration news

Propanc Biopharma, Inc.'s POP1 program with the University of Jaén is the main research collaboration story in this mix. Academic partnership news matters because it lifts scientific credibility and shows outside review of the pipeline. For a biotech with early-stage assets, that kind of validation can help build trust with investors and partners.

  • POP1 is the key announcement.
  • University backing adds credibility.
  • Signals external pipeline validation.

Price

Icon

No product list price

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. has no marketed product, so there is no public list price for PRP. PRP remains preclinical, which means pricing has not moved past research-stage planning. In the latest reported fiscal period, the Company still had no product sales, so price discovery is not yet relevant.

Icon

No commercial sales

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. has no commercial sales, so product revenue is $0 and pricing is not customer-facing. The company is still in development mode, focused on research and clinical progress rather than market launch. With no sold products, there is no active price list, discounting, or revenue mix to analyze.

Explore a Preview
Icon

Preclinical pipeline only

Because Propanc Biopharma is still preclinical, price discovery is effectively 0 today: there is no approved therapy and no commercial sales to anchor a market price. Clinical testing and regulatory review must come first, and only then can pricing be set. Any future price will depend on trial results, FDA approval, and reimbursement, not current pipeline assets.

No reimbursement terms

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. has not published payer, reimbursement, or discount terms for this Price item. That is normal this early: such terms usually appear near launch, after pricing, access, and coverage talks start. Propanc is still not at that stage.

  • No payer terms disclosed
  • No rebate or discount policy
  • Pre-launch, so access is undefined

Future pricing undisclosed

Propanc Biopharma, Inc. has not disclosed future treatment pricing, so the asset is still effectively unpriced. Any final price would depend on trial results, FDA or other approval, and payer access terms. As a clinical-stage program, there is no published commercial price to anchor valuation yet.

  • Price not disclosed
  • Approval still needed
  • Payer access will shape net price
